What is Multi-Tabling in Online Poker?
Multi-tabling in online poker refers to playing at multiple tables simultaneously. This strategy is popular among experienced players who aim to maximize their winnings per hour by participating in more hands. While it requires focus and discipline, multi-tabling can be a profitable approach for players who understand its nuances and can manage the added complexity.

Benefits of Multi-Tabling in Online Poker
Multi-tabling offers several advantages, particularly for skilled players. Here are the main benefits:
Increased Profit Potential
By playing multiple tables, you can increase the number of hands you play per hour, leading to higher overall earnings. Even if you maintain a modest win rate per table, the cumulative profits can be substantial.
Reduced Downtime
In single-table play, players often experience long periods of inactivity while waiting for good hands. Multi-tabling eliminates this downtime, ensuring you are consistently involved in action across several tables.
Better Focus on Strategy
Paradoxically, multi-tabling can improve your focus. With more tables in play, you’re less likely to overanalyze marginal hands or get bored, allowing you to stick to a solid, disciplined strategy.
Rewards and Bonuses
Most online poker platforms offer loyalty rewards, rakebacks, and bonuses based on the volume of play. Multi-tabling allows you to accumulate these perks faster, adding to your overall profitability.
Challenges of Multi-Tabling
While multi-tabling can be rewarding, it also comes with challenges:
Increased Complexity
Managing multiple tables requires quick decision-making and the ability to process large amounts of information simultaneously. For beginners, this can lead to errors or missed opportunities.
Reduced Focus on Individual Hands
Playing too many tables can lead to “autopilot” mode, where you make decisions mechanically without fully analyzing each situation. This can reduce your overall win rate.
Mental Fatigue
The mental demands of multi-tabling can be exhausting, especially during long sessions. Fatigue increases the likelihood of mistakes and decreases your ability to adapt to opponents’ strategies.
Tips for Successful Multi-Tabling
To master multi-tabling, you need to adopt effective strategies and tools. Here are key tips to help you succeed:
Start with a Manageable Number of Tables
If you’re new to multi-tabling, start with just two or three tables and gradually increase the number as you become more comfortable. Jumping into too many tables at once can be overwhelming and counterproductive.
Use Efficient Layouts
Most online poker platforms allow you to customize your table layout. Options include:
- Tiled Layouts: Displays all tables on the screen without overlapping. Ideal for smaller setups.
- Stacked Layouts: Overlaps tables in a single stack, switching focus to the table requiring action.
- Cascading Layouts: Slightly overlaps tables for easy visibility.
Choose a layout that suits your screen size and personal preferences.
Play Familiar Games
Stick to the games and stakes you are most comfortable with when multi-tabling. Avoid experimenting with new formats or unfamiliar opponents, as this adds unnecessary complexity.
Focus on Pre-Flop Strategy
To save time and reduce decision-making pressure, adopt a solid pre-flop strategy. Use hand charts or rely on your experience to make quick, consistent pre-flop decisions.
Use Tracking Software
Tools like PokerTracker and Hold’em Manager can help you keep track of your hands, monitor opponent tendencies, and identify areas for improvement. These tools are invaluable for multi-tabling, as they provide real-time insights without requiring you to focus on individual opponents manually.
Set Stop-Loss Limits
Avoid overextending yourself during losing sessions. Set a stop-loss limit to ensure you don’t continue playing under suboptimal conditions.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
While multi-tabling can boost your profitability, there are common mistakes that players should avoid:
- Playing Too Many Tables Too Soon: Adding too many tables can lead to costly mistakes and a lower overall win rate.
- Ignoring Table Selection: Not all tables are equally profitable. Take the time to select tables with weaker opponents, even if you’re playing multiple games.
- Chasing Volume Over Quality: Prioritize making sound decisions over simply increasing the number of hands you play.
Tools and Platforms for Multi-Tabling
To optimize your multi-tabling experience, consider using tools and choosing platforms that cater to multi-tablers:
- Poker Platforms: Sites like PokerStars, partypoker, and GG Poker offer multi-tabling-friendly features such as customizable table layouts and hotkeys.
- Tracking Software: PokerTracker, Hold’em Manager, and Hand2Note provide essential data for managing multiple tables efficiently.
- Hotkey Tools: Applications like TableNinja allow you to assign hotkeys for common actions (e.g., fold, call, raise) to speed up your decision-making process.
